Anonymous (Follower of: Luca Cambiaso)

Four putti flying

XVI century. Wash, Pencil, Grey-brown ink, Pencil ground on paper.
Not on display

Two other directly corresponding School versions of this drawing are know: one is in the Uffizi, Florence; the second, with the putto top left cut away, is in the Galleria Estense, Modena (inv. no. 661). A variant design showing the same composition but with two further putti, also a School drawing, is in the Louvre (inv. no. 9294).
